I have used (or tried to use) Jacobs with two of my sons and both of them had "issues" with the program. Their main complaint is that Jacobs doesn't explain things well enough and they often felt left to figure things out on their own. I think Jacobs takes a somewhat inductive approach in its teaching style and my guys prefer a more straight-forward approach such as Lial's. If your son is good at math, he may prefer the engaging style of Jacobs though. I don't know of any place to look at samples of it online. I think you can see samples of Singapore and Teaching Textbooks online at their websites. I haven't used them though, so I can't offer any opinion on them.
